    Algebra 2 builds upon the concepts learned in Algebra 1, introducing new ideas such as quadratic equations, functions, and graphing. The course focuses on applying mathematical models to real-world problems, fostering critical thinking and problem-solving skills. Students learn to manipulate algebraic expressions, solve equations, and analyze functions using various techniques, including graphing and solving systems of equations.

        In the United States, Algebra 2 is a fundamental course that prepares students for advanced math and science courses, including calculus and engineering. Its importance lies in its ability to develop problem-solving skills, logical thinking, and analytical reasoning. As the US education system continues to emphasize math and science education, Algebra 2 has become a crucial stepping stone for students aiming for STEM careers.
